    Winter 2016, I noticed my HVAC system was not heating my home as efficiently as it used to,…read moreespecially compared to winter 2015, which was a much colder winter with multiple single-temp days. What to do but schedule an appointment with the same folks who fixed my HVAC last time, McBroom Air. Houston McBroom, owner of McBroom Air, came to my home about 2.5 years ago when I was having the exact opposite problem (detailed in my original review below). It was summer 2012 and my HVAC was not producing cold air. Houston quickly diagnosed the problem, replaced a capacitor, and I was up and running again. I was very pleased with the service. Unfortunately, my problem wasn't so simple this time around. My 12-year-old International Comfort Products HVAC system had finally bitten the dust. The inner coil on my air handler had leaked my system almost completely out of refrigerant. The coil was visibly icing up. Houston took readings and my refrigerant levels were down to about 5 to 10 psi. A fully charged system would read about 65 psi. Since the part (coil) was no longer in production by the manufacturer (as of around summer 2014 according to Houston), I could not have just the part replaced. Therefore, my two options according to Houston were: 1. Install a new heat pump, air handler, and heater package. Quote: $4,800. 2. Install a new air handler and heater package. Quote: $3,000 (approx.). I asked Houston what he thought about recharging my system. He did not recommend it and I don't blame him. If he recharged my system, there was no telling how long the charge would last before most of the refrigerant would leak out again. For years, I had experienced this same exact problem at another property. Also, the cost of the refrigerant required for my system (R-22) skyrocketed in recent years because the EPA is phasing out the stuff. R-22 is no longer produced nor imported into the United States for environmental reasons. The new standard is R-410A. I decided to go with option 1 for the simple reason of long-term comfort and savings. A brand new inner and outer unit would be quieter and more energy efficient. The new system will eventually pay for itself in savings on my monthly electric bills over a number of years (I think Houston said 7 years). It's worth it to me. In summer 2009, I had Estes Air replace an approximately 8-year-old heat pump and air handler for about $4,000 at a different property. The outer coil on that system developed a leak early on (in hindsight, probably still under the warranty period). I had to get the system recharged about once per year until the leak got so bad the system could barely hold a charge. Estes replaced that old, broken-down system with a new 2-ton 13-SEER Payne heat pump, air handler, heating elements, and thermostat -- basically, all the same equipment I needed from McBroom. Houston recommended a 2-ton 14-SEER Carrier system, slightly bigger and more efficient than the one I had installed by Estes at my other place.
